Thoughts for Times and Seasons is a collection of essays and reflections by John Timbs, a 19th-century British author and journalist. Published in 1872, the book covers a wide range of topics, including history, literature, science, and philosophy. Timbs offers his thoughts on various subjects, from the meaning of life to the latest discoveries in science. He also reflects on the changing seasons and the passage of time, offering insights into the natural world and the human experience. Throughout the book, Timbs draws on his extensive knowledge and experience to offer readers a thoughtful and engaging perspective on the world around them.
